SENSODYNER (Original)

sensodyne original

Active Ingredient:

  • Strontium chloride 10%

How it works

  • Strontium chloride (SrCl2)

sensodyne original how it works.

  • Blocks the liquid in dentin tubule. Strontium Chloride will replace the position of Calcium in dentin by forming Calcium Strontium Xydroxyapat Chrystal.
  • A little bit salty.

SENSODYNE Cool Gel

  • Potassium nitrate 5%, Fluoride
  • Brush your teeth twice a day

How it works

  • Potassium nitrate (KNO3)
    Potassium nitrate
    When the toothpaste is mixed with the saliva, KCL will release K ions. K ions will slip under the dentin tubule and cover the nerves in pulps, decreasing sensitivity of the nerves.

Sensodyne as the Support of Bleaching Treatment

  • Based on a research by Cooper, Bookmeyer, and Bowles in 1992, active ingredient in bleaching can penetrate inside the enamel and dentin and reach the pulp chamber and increase sensitivity of teeth as a form of symptoms of reversible pulpits.
  • Sensodyne with active ingredient of potassium nitrat dan fluoride (Sensodyne F) when used before and during bleaching treatment can be used to solve tooth sensitivity problems as a side effect of bleaching treatment (Haywood, 2005)

N=220 subject; 2 weeks before a scheduled bleaching until 14th day of bleaching using Sensodyne FreshMint vs regular fluoride toothpaste (Crest™).
